How they compare

Palestine currently reports 9.2% against 9.0% in East Timor, a difference of 0.2%.

The two have swapped places 5 times across 14 shared years of data; in 2008 it was East Timor ahead.

East Timor ranks 60th and Palestine ranks 59th of 177 countries.

East Timor has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

Children out of school are the percentage of primary-school-age children who are not enrolled in primary or secondary school. Children in the official primary age group that are in preprimary education should be considered out of school.
